Dr Arthur Clifton Mckinley Ctr - Brookville, PA · 90 beds · non profit - corporation CMS Care Compare · data as of Aug 2026

  • Staffing 3.7 nurse hours per resident-day — above median in Pennsylvania
  • 2 health deficiencies at the last standard survey (CMS severity score 12) — top quarter
  • No fines or payment denials in 3 years
BScore 64 · GoodSee Full Grade

Penn Highlands Jefferson Manor - Brookville, PA · 160 beds · non profit - corporation CMS Care Compare · data as of Aug 2026

  • Staffing 3.9 nurse hours per resident-day — top quarter in Pennsylvania
  • 4 health deficiencies at the last standard survey (CMS severity score 48) — above median
  • $15,160 in fines in 3 years
BScore 59 · GoodSee Full Grade

How we grade nursing homes

What data goes into a grade?
CMS Care Compare: Nurse staffing (30), Health inspections (30), Quality measures (25), Penalties (15). Each metric is percentile-ranked against Pennsylvania facilities in the same size band; A ≥ 72, B ≥ 58, C ≥ 42, D ≥ 28, F below. Facilities with under 60% of data are shown as "Not graded".
Can a facility pay to improve its grade?
No. Grades are computed from public data and have no editable field. Nothing on this page is sponsored.
Is a grade a substitute for visiting?
No. Use it to shortlist, then visit, ask for the latest inspection report, and talk to residents' families.
